Streaming JMCS is the next step in providing rich multimedia experience for 3G mobile users. A 3G
mobile user can download and install a Java based application that will enable him to dynamically
“stream” video contents to his mobile device using the high speed 3G network. Streaming is unlike
“downloading” since the later will be bounded by the available storage within the mobile device not
to mention the waiting period to “download” before playback can commence. Streaming will enable
“video on demand” media to be broadcasted live to the mobile device irrelevant of the device's
storage capacity were playback can start almost immediately. We are at the age of multimedia
communication devices and this technology could be used in education, businesses, services and
entertainment to name few.

The system is composed of 3 basic modules bound by protocols that will guarantee high quality
media and uninterruptible video playback as long as the 3G connection holds. These basic units are
the “Client MIDlet”; the java application loaded on the user's 3G mobile phone, a “web server” to
handle login & authentications guaranteeing a secure experience for both the client and the
service provider, and a “streaming server” responsible for providing the broadcast ability to
connected clients making use of industry standard CODECs namely 3gp and MP4. The system will
also provide important statistical data that is useful for any service provider to enhance the quality
of their service
